U+18837 "𘠷" Tangut Component-056 is a graphic element from the Tangut script, a complex logographic writing system used for the extinct Tangut language of the Western Xia dynasty (1038–1227). This character represents one of the many fundamental building blocks, or radical like components, that combine to form full Tangut characters, each with specific phonetic or semantic functions. Its inclusion in Unicode, as part of the Tangut Components block, supports the digital encoding and preservation of this historical script, enabling scholars to study and reconstruct the language's intricate composition and usage in manuscripts.
